Output 1bbac389740ed51c5052e85994f809be4a5ada5fa23d5835e6c6e6862b75b71e:3

value
59853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b42fe9fc7fc7b778b5990842c59051b55872563d OP_EQUAL
address
3J7kxCNmkNKtymVpG8reqCm7ujwA64rtk8
transaction
1bbac389740ed51c5052e85994f809be4a5ada5fa23d5835e6c6e6862b75b71e